Classic Books Library presents this brand new edition of Nietzche's philosophical text Beyond Good and Evil , published in 1886. Building on his previous works, this text challenges traditional perceptions of how truth and knowledge are established, and each chapter is dedicated to a different concept. Beyond Good and Evil explores the dogmatism and prejudice in the philosophy of the past, reveals the psychological sense of control underpinning morality and discusses the complexities of the human soul. Friedrich Wilhelm Nietzsche (1844-1900) was a German philologist, philosopher, poet and scholar. His work covered many topics, but he is most famous for his critiques of culture, morality and truth. Nietzche's philosophical writing went on to influence many great philosophers, artists, writers and composers of the 20th Century.
